Output ad31e78b2eec8214d00febc9106e724605b2225dcee964d84a1cde07e16dfcdc:1

value
58255260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f2ec8e81f6a83e458b77e6fee07bbc21a755939 OP_EQUAL
address
3BptyW2VaC7iaxjdrh58aBA9BYJnFuTxpi
transaction
ad31e78b2eec8214d00febc9106e724605b2225dcee964d84a1cde07e16dfcdc
spent
true